"Rumored Switch 2 Launch Title: Top-Selling Fighting Game"

The gaming world is buzzing with excitement as Nintendo officially announces the Nintendo Switch 2, although details are still sparse. A notable insider, eXtas1s, renowned for their accurate leaks, has shared intriguing information about one of the upcoming titles for the new console. According to eXtas1s, the highly anticipated fighting game, Dragon Ball: Sparking! ZERO, is set to be a launch title for the Nintendo Switch 2.

Developed and published by Bandai Namco, Dragon Ball: Sparking! ZERO has already made waves in the gaming community. Released in October 2024, the game achieved remarkable success by selling over 3 million copies within just 24 hours. This impressive feat underscores its status as one of Bandai Namco's best-selling titles, particularly noteworthy within the genre of arena fighters.

eXtas1s emphasized that Bandai Namco's strong partnership with Nintendo plays a significant role in bringing Dragon Ball: Sparking! ZERO to the Switch 2 at launch. This collaboration is set to continue with other popular game ports, including Tekken 8 and Elden Ring, further solidifying the relationship between the two gaming giants.

As the Nintendo Switch 2 gears up for its debut, fans eagerly await more details about its features and the full lineup of launch titles. With Dragon Ball: Sparking! ZERO leading the charge, the new console is poised to make a significant impact in the gaming market.
